MIMFest!

 

Inaugural global music weekend at the

Musical Instrument Museum a hit with all ages

The Musical Instrument Museum hosted its inaugural music festival, MIMFest, on Oct. 18 and 19. The weekend event featured more than 20 performances on three stages; a variety of local, street-style performances; delicious, globally inspired cuisine from 13 of the Valley’s best food trucks; and fun, family-friendly activities in the Kids’ Zone.

MIM’s inaugural music festival was a great success. From the beginning, our mission was to showcase music from around the globe and share the talents of world-renowned musical acts. MIMFest brought world-class artists from Ethiopia, Ireland, Cuba and beyond together with blues, bluegrass and Tex-Mex musicians from the U.S. It was a festive celebration that brought MIM’s mission and passion for music to life, and it was one more demonstration of how music can bring the disparate parts of the world together. And it was a big step in bringing Phoenix to the forefront of the global music scene,” said Lowell Pickett, artistic director for MIMFest.

“Many community members have already reached out to tell us how much they enjoyed this event, and we look forward to hosting more events that foster appreciation of diverse cultures through dynamic programming and exceptional musical performances.
